Executives are becoming more concerned about sensitive data in international transactions. These files, commonly referred to as hypersensitive as they are the crown jewels of a business and carry greater risk if they fall into the wrong hands. Cybercriminals can target any sensitive file which contains financial information, personal data or trade secrets.

The misuse, loss, or unauthorised access to sensitive information could adversely impact the national security, the operation of federal programs or the privacy rights to which individuals are entitled under the Privacy Act. See also controlled non-classified information (CUI).

Moderate sensitivity information is data for which there is a legal obligation to safeguard but the leakage of this information will only cause minor harm to the individuals and organizations concerned. Examples include plans for building and donor records, data on intellectual property, information about IT services, visas and other travel documents as well as security information.
